Hey all! I'm Simon, I'm 36 and from Norfolk UK. I'm thinking of trading in my old BMW 318ti Compact for a Fabia. I'm gonna go test drive one this afternoon...it's a 54 reg 1.4 16v Ambiente, 33,000 miles, gun metal grey, full skoda service history and 2 previous owners. It's up for £3495 which, considering the mileage, I think is a reasonable price...although there are 1 or 2 parking scuffs on the body work and it needs taxing, so there's room for bargaining. Are there any issues I should be looking for as I don't know a great deal about the Fabia.

Cheers people!

Check in the rear footwells for any moisture, pressing down on the carpet should show if there is. This would be leaky rear door carriers which is extremely common and you should haggle with the dealer to fix it should they be leaking. Its easier getting it sorted now rather than when you notice it in the winter whe its always raining, making it extremely bothersome to repair.
